Connessione ad Apache Iceberg

Impara a creare una connessione ad Apache Iceberg in OCI GoldenGate.

Prima di iniziare

Prima di creare la connessione, assicurarsi di:

Crea la connessione

Per creare la connessione a Apache Iceberg, effettuare le operazioni riportate di seguito:
  1. Nella pagina Panoramica di OCI GoldenGate, fare clic su Connessioni.
    È inoltre possibile fare clic su Crea connessione nella sezione Introduzione e passare al passo 3.
  2. Nella pagina Connessioni fare clic su Crea connessione.
  3. Nella pagina Crea connessione, completare i campi come indicato di seguito.
    1. Per Nome, immettere un nome per la connessione.
    2. (Facoltativo) In Descrizione, immettere una descrizione che consenta di distinguere questa connessione da altre.
    3. (Solo per GoldenGate nel multicloud) Selezionare la propria sottoscrizione, quindi completare i campi seguenti.
      1. Nell'elenco a discesa Compartimento selezionare il compartimento in cui risiede l'ancora risorsa.
      2. Selezionare l'area partner multicloud.
      3. Seleziona la tua zona di disponibilità dei partner. Le opzioni disponibili vengono popolate in base all'area partner multicloud selezionata.
    4. Per Compartimento, selezionare il compartimento in cui creare la connessione.
    5. Per Tipo, in Big Data, selezionare Apache Iceberg.
    6. Selezionare un tipo di catalogo dall'elenco a discesa, quindi completare i campi del catalogo pertinenti:
      1. Per Glue, immettere l'ID collegamento.
      2. Per Hadoop non sono necessarie informazioni aggiuntive.
      3. Per Nessie, specificare:
        • URI: immettere l'URI del catalogo Nessie.
        • Diramazione: immettere il nome di diramazione attivo da cui Nessie legge e scrive i metadati della tabella.
      4. Per Polaris, specificare:
        • URI: immettere l'URI del catalogo Polaris.
        • Nome: immettere il nome in cui Polaris registra le tabelle Iceberg.
        • ID client: immettere l'ID client OAuth da utilizzare per l'autenticazione.
        • Segreto client: selezionare il segreto client oppure fare clic su Crea segreto client per crearne uno nuovo. Se si sceglie di creare un nuovo segreto client, fornire le informazioni riportate di seguito.
          • Nome
          • (Facoltativo) Descrizione
          • Selezionare il compartimento in cui risiede il segreto delle proprietà.
          • Selezionare il Vault in cui memorizzare il segreto delle proprietà.
          • Selezionare la chiave di cifratura da utilizzare.
          • Immettere la password utente, quindi confermare la password utente.
        • Ruolo principale: immettere il ruolo Fiocco di neve utilizzato per accedere a Polaris.
      5. Per Rest, specificare:
        • URI: immettere l'URL di base per l'API del catalogo REST.
        • Segreto proprietà: selezionare il segreto proprietà oppure fare clic su Crea segreto proprietà per crearne uno nuovo. Se si sceglie di creare un nuovo segreto proprietà, fornire le informazioni riportate di seguito.
          • Nome
          • (Facoltativo) Descrizione
          • Selezionare il compartimento in cui risiede il segreto delle proprietà.
          • Selezionare il Vault in cui memorizzare il segreto delle proprietà.
          • Selezionare la chiave di cifratura da utilizzare.
          • Caricare l'ID segreto proprietà.
    7. Selezionare un tipo di memorizzazione dall'elenco a discesa, quindi completare i campi di memorizzazione pertinenti:
  4. Espandere l'area Mostra opzioni avanzate È possibile configurare le opzioni riportate di seguito.
    • Sicurezza
      • Deselezionare Usa segreti vault se si preferisce non utilizzare segreti password per questa connessione. Se l'opzione non viene selezionata:
        • Selezionare Usa chiave di cifratura gestita da Oracle per lasciare a Oracle tutta la gestione delle chiavi di cifratura.
        • Selezionare Usa chiave di cifratura gestita dal cliente per selezionare una chiave di cifratura specifica memorizzata nel vault OCI per cifrare le credenziali di connessione.
    • Connettività di rete
      • Endpoint condiviso per condividere un endpoint con la distribuzione assegnata. È necessario consentire la connettività dall'IP in entrata della distribuzione.
      • Endpoint dedicato, per il traffico di rete attraverso un endpoint dedicato nella subnet assegnata nella tua VCN. È necessario consentire la connettività dagli IP in entrata di questa connessione.

        Nota

        • Se un collegamento dedicato rimane non assegnato per sette giorni, il servizio lo converte in una connessione condivisa.
        • Ulteriori informazioni sulla connettività di Oracle GoldenGate.
    • Attributi di sicurezza: aggiungere attributi di sicurezza per controllare l'accesso a questa connessione utilizzando Zero Trust Packet Routing (ZPR).
    • Tag: Aggiunge tag per organizzare le risorse.
  5. Fare clic su Crea.
Una volta creata, la connessione viene visualizzata nell'elenco Connessione. Assicurarsi di assegnare la connessione a una distribuzione per utilizzarla in un processo di replica dei dati.

Problemi noti

Problema con le connessioni Apache Iceberg in OCI GoldenGate

Se si verifica il seguente errore durante l'utilizzo delle connessioni Apache Iceberg, aprire un ticket di supporto, condividere i dettagli e il messaggio di errore:

ERROR 2025-07-08 13:34:09.000481 [main] -  Parameter [awsSecretKey] is missing in the
      connection payload. Parameter [awsSecretKey] is missing in the connection payload.